Foundation Jacking in Tampa, FL
Foundation jacking services are designed to stabilize and lift settling or uneven building foundations, helping to restore structural integrity and prevent further damage. This process typically involves inserting specialized equipment beneath the foundation to raise it back to its proper position, making it suitable for a range of projects such as homes experiencing foundation settlement, sinking, or cracking, as well as commercial buildings needing structural correction. Property owners interested in foundation jacking should understand that the service is a targeted solution to address foundation issues caused by soil movement, moisture changes, or aging structures, and it can help improve safety and property value.
Before requesting foundation jacking, homeowners often want to know about the signs indicating foundation problems, including cracked walls, uneven floors, or sticking doors and windows. It’s also important to consider the extent of the foundation movement and whether additional repairs, such as soil stabilization or drainage improvements, might be necessary. Understanding the scope of work and potential outcomes can help property owners make informed decisions about addressing foundation concerns effectively.

Foundation Jacking Questions
What is foundation jacking? Foundation jacking is a process that lifts and stabilizes a sinking or uneven foundation using hydraulic methods.
When is foundation jacking needed? It is typically necessary when a property shows signs of shifting, such as c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ors that don't close properly.
How does foundation jacking work? The process involves installing hydraulic piers or jacks beneath the foundation to lift and support it to a proper level.
What types of projects benefit from foundation jacking? Residential homes, commercial buildings, and other structures experiencing settlement or foundation movement can benefit from this service.
